- Implemented support for temporary security credentials for the Read-Only
S3 (ROS3) file driver.

When using temporary security credentials, one also needs to specify a
session/security token next to the access key id and secret access key.
This token can be specified by the new API function H5Pset_fapl_ros3_token().
The API function H5Pget_fapl_ros3_token() can be used to retrieve
the currently set token.

/*-------------------------------------------------------------------------
* Function: H5Pget_fapl_ros3_token
*
* Purpose: Returns session/security token of the ros3 file access
* property list though the function arguments.
*
* Return: Success: Non-negative
*
* Failure: Negative
*
* Programmer: Jan-Willem Blokland
* 2023-05-26
*
*-------------------------------------------------------------------------
*/
herr_t
H5Pget_fapl_ros3_token(hid_t fapl_id, size_t size, char *token_dst /*out*/)
{
H5P_genplist_t *plist = NULL;
char *token_src;
htri_t token_exists;
size_t tokenlen = 0;
herr_t ret_value = SUCCEED;

FUNC_ENTER_API(FAIL)
H5TRACE3("e", "izx", fapl_id, size, token_dst);

#if ROS3_DEBUG
HDfprintf(stdout, "H5Pget_fapl_ros3_token() called.\n");
#endif

if (size == 0)
HGOTO_ERROR(H5E_ARGS, H5E_BADVALUE, FAIL, "size cannot be zero.")
if (token_dst == NULL)
HGOTO_ERROR(H5E_ARGS, H5E_BADVALUE, FAIL, "token_dst is NULL")

if (NULL == (plist = H5P_object_verify(fapl_id, H5P_FILE_ACCESS)))
HGOTO_ERROR(H5E_PLIST, H5E_BADTYPE, FAIL, "not a file access property list")
if (H5FD_ROS3 != H5P_peek_driver(plist))
HGOTO_ERROR(H5E_PLIST, H5E_BADVALUE, FAIL, "incorrect VFL driver")
if ((token_exists = H5P_exist_plist(plist, ROS3_TOKEN_PROP_NAME)) < 0)
HGOTO_ERROR(H5E_PLIST, H5E_CANTGET, FAIL, "failed to check if property token exists in plist")
if (token_exists) {
if (H5P_get(plist, ROS3_TOKEN_PROP_NAME, &token_src) < 0)
HGOTO_ERROR(H5E_PLIST, H5E_CANTGET, FAIL, "unable to get token value")
}

/* Copy the token data out */
tokenlen = HDstrlen(token_src);
if (size <= tokenlen) {
tokenlen = size - 1;
jhendersonHDF marked this conversation as resolved.
Show resolved Hide resolved
}
H5MM_memcpy(token_dst, token_src, sizeof(char) * tokenlen);
token_dst[tokenlen] = '\0';
jhendersonHDF marked this conversation as resolved.
Show resolved Hide resolved

done:
FUNC_LEAVE_API(ret_value)
} /* end H5Pget_fapl_ros3_token() */

/*-------------------------------------------------------------------------
* Function: H5Pset_fapl_ros3_token()
*
* Purpose: Modify the file access property list to use the H5FD_ROS3
* driver defined in this source file by adding or
* modifying the session/security token property.
*
* Return: SUCCEED/FAIL
*
* Programmer: Jan-Willem Blokland
* 2023-05-26
*
*-------------------------------------------------------------------------
*/
herr_t
H5Pset_fapl_ros3_token(hid_t fapl_id, const char *token)
{
H5P_genplist_t *plist = NULL;
char *token_src;
htri_t token_exists;
herr_t ret_value = SUCCEED;

FUNC_ENTER_API(FAIL)
H5TRACE2("e", "i*s", fapl_id, token);

#if ROS3_DEBUG
HDfprintf(stdout, "H5Pset_fapl_ros3_token() called.\n");
#endif

if (fapl_id == H5P_DEFAULT)
HGOTO_ERROR(H5E_PLIST, H5E_BADVALUE, FAIL, "can't set values in default property list")
if (NULL == (plist = H5P_object_verify(fapl_id, H5P_FILE_ACCESS)))
HGOTO_ERROR(H5E_PLIST, H5E_BADTYPE, FAIL, "not a file access property list")
if (H5FD_ROS3 != H5P_peek_driver(plist))
HGOTO_ERROR(H5E_PLIST, H5E_BADVALUE, FAIL, "incorrect VFL driver")
if (HDstrlen(token) > H5FD_ROS3_MAX_SECRET_TOK_LEN)
HGOTO_ERROR(H5E_PLIST, H5E_BADVALUE, FAIL,
"specified token exceeds the internally specified maximum string length")

if ((token_exists = H5P_exist_plist(plist, ROS3_TOKEN_PROP_NAME)) < 0)
HGOTO_ERROR(H5E_PLIST, H5E_CANTGET, FAIL, "failed to check if property token exists in plist")

if (token_exists) {
if (H5P_get(plist, ROS3_TOKEN_PROP_NAME, &token_src) < 0)
HGOTO_ERROR(H5E_PLIST, H5E_CANTGET, FAIL, "unable to get token value")

memcpy(token_src, token, HDstrlen(token) + 1);
}
else {
token_src = (char *)malloc(sizeof(char) * (H5FD_ROS3_MAX_SECRET_TOK_LEN + 1));
if (token_src == NULL)
HGOTO_ERROR(H5E_RESOURCE, H5E_NOSPACE, FAIL, "cannot make space for token_src variable.");
memcpy(token_src, token, HDstrlen(token) + 1);
if (H5P_insert(plist, ROS3_TOKEN_PROP_NAME, sizeof(char *), &token_src, NULL, NULL, NULL, NULL,
H5FD__ros3_str_token_delete, H5FD__ros3_str_token_copy, H5FD__ros3_str_token_cmp,
H5FD__ros3_str_token_close) < 0)
HGOTO_ERROR(H5E_PLIST, H5E_CANTREGISTER, FAIL, "unable to register property in plist")
}

done:
FUNC_LEAVE_API(ret_value)
} /* end H5Pset_fapl_ros3_token() */
